Acupuncture can be a popular treatment for those who have to contend with chronic arthritis. Studies have shown that acupuncture can bring relief for arthritis sufferers. If this method is something you want to try, keep doing it, as doing it one time will not help in the long run.

Be aware of what you eat. Keep tabs on the food that you consume, and take note of when you feel your symptoms flare-up. You might be able to track down exactly what is causing it.

Having strong abs has actually been proven to help alleviate joint pain. Research indicates that toned ab muscles help you with the way you hold your body when standing, therefore limiting damage on the joints. Be careful not overwork yourself during your workout.

Try to switch between cold and hot treatments. You need to reduce the swelling of your joint to ease the pain which is achieved by using both hot and cold treatments. Moderation, though, is best for this treatment because over use of the hot and cold packs can possibly irritate the condition as time goes by. Shoot for twice daily as a maximum.

Strength training is proven to help with the pain caused by arthritis. Moderate intensity strength training helps improve your mobility and emotional condition. Remember that this method will give results in the long term commitment and not quick fix.

A hot shower or bath can soothe the pain brought on by arthritis. This heat can give you relief by relaxing your tendons and muscles. A heating pad with moist heat also be helpful. You can find a moist heating pad in most drug stores and they are safe to use when wet.

If you suffer with arthritis, you might want to utilize fish oil. Studies have shown that omega-3 fatty acids, which are in fish oil, help minimize pain and joint inflammation. Supermarkets and health food stores carry a variety of fish oil supplements.

To get through the emotional issues you experience with arthritis, consider going to counseling. Constant pain can affect you on an emotional level, leaving you drained and vulnerable. A licensed therapist can help you deal with the emotions associated with your diagnosis in a safe and confidential way.
